If we want to investigate the connection between hospital capacity and Covid-19 deaths as a group of public health researchers, we could begin by compiling information on the number of Covid-19 cases and deaths in various states in the United States as well as the hospital capacities in those states.

This could remember information for the quantity of emergency clinic beds, ICU beds, ventilators, and other basic clinical assets accessible in each state. After that, we could look into the connection between Covid-19 deaths and hospital capacity through statistical analysis.

This could include utilizing devices, for example, relapse investigation to decide whether there is a connection between's emergency clinic limit and Coronavirus passings, controlling for other significant factors like populace thickness, socioeconomics, and the general nature of the state's medical services framework.

We could likewise direct meetings with medical services experts and overseers in states with high emergency clinic abilities to study how their clinics have had the option to answer the Coronavirus pandemic. Best practices, difficulties encountered, and opportunities for improvement might be discussed here. Finally, we might be able to share our findings with policymakers and other stakeholders to help them make decisions about the capacity of the healthcare system and how to respond to a pandemic.    

This could include recommending that hospital capacity be increased in states with higher rates of Covid-19 deaths, that healthcare providers and public health officials better coordinate and communicate, and that money be invested in public health infrastructure to prevent future pandemics.

Suppose that two fair dice are rolled. What is the probability that the total is bigger than or equal to 3

Answers

The probability that the total is bigger than or equal to 3 is given as follows:

35/36.

How to calculate a probability?

The two parameters that are needed to calculate a probability are listed as follows:

Number of desired outcomes for the context of a problem or experiment.Number of total outcomes for the context of a problem or experiment.

Then the probability is given as the division of the number of desired outcomes by the number of total outcomes.

The total number of outcomes when two dice are rolled is given as follows:

6² = 36.

There is only one outcome with a sum less than 3, which is given as follows:

(1,1).

Hence the probability that the total is bigger than or equal to 3 is given as follows:

1 - 1/36 = 36/36 - 1/36 = 35/36.

how to tell if equations are parallel perpendicular or neither

Answers

To determine if equations are parallel, perpendicular, or neither, you need to examine the slopes of the lines represented by the equations.

The slope of a line is calculated using the formula m = (y2 - y1) / (x2 - x1). The slope-intercept equation y = mx + c can be used to identify the slope and y-intercept of a line, where m represents the slope, while c represents the y-intercept.

If two equations are parallel, they will have the same slope.

If two equations are perpendicular, then the product of the two slopes should equal -1. This also means that if one slope is m, the other must be -1/m. If the slope of one line is zero, the line is horizontal, and any line perpendicular to it has a slope of undefined.

The two lines are neither parallel nor perpendicular if their slopes are not the same or opposite reciprocals of each other.
